When it comes to facilities, Seer Green & Jordans offers a range of essentials that cover basic commuter needs. The ticket office is available on weekdays from 06:10 to 10:40, ensuring you can purchase or collect your tickets comfortably. Ticket machines are present and designed to be accessible to all, making your entry and exit swift and uncomplicated. The station features a step-free access option, though it's limited mainly to platform 2 for London-bound trains. Customer assistance is readily available through help points and staff presence during ticket office hours to assist travelers with queries and enhancements to their experience.
Accessibility is a concern that's addressed with thought. There are some limitations, such as the lack of accessible toilets, but provisions like induction loops, accessible ticket machines, and ramps are present. Those needing assistance can book it in advance for peace of mind using the Passenger Assist initiative—more details can be found here.
While the station doesn't cater to rail replacement buses due to tricky road access, travelers are encouraged to use the help point at the station to arrange alternative transportation like taxis to nearby Chiltern Railways stations. Parton station may be small, but it's equipped with some essential amenities to facilitate your travel. Although the station lacks a ticket office, rest assured that there are ticket machines on-site for purchasing or collecting pre-bought tickets, and these machines are accessible, featuring induction loops for those with hearing impairments. While Smartcards can be issued here, it’s important to note there are no smartcard validators available.
Accessibility could be a challenge; the station is classified as a Category C, which means there is no step-free access available. Platform access involves navigating several steps, and unfortunately, there are no ramps. Thus, if you require assistance, it might be best to plan with that in mind. There are no waiting rooms, nor is there available seating apart from a few benches.
When it comes to onward travel, Parton offers a handful of connections to ensure your journey doesn't end on the platform. Rail replacement services are close by with bus stops positioned conveniently on the A595. Travelers can also check out the local bus services for a wider reach in the area, or use the Cab4you service for ordering taxis. For more localized travel and help planning bus routes, the busline at 0871 200 2233 could be a great tool.
